He's #4 on the Cowboys depth chart ... the only place where it matters. If he was any higher than #4, they wouldn't have shipped him out for a 7th round draft pick.

Crayton is a productive slot WR where he never has to face press coverage, gets a clean release, doesn't have to rely on athleticism, faces the other teams 3rd or 4th best defensive back and can roam around free and exploit gaps in the defenses. Playing as starter outside against man to man coverage against an average starting NFL cornerback? He's a trainwreck. Those kind of guys are a dime a dozen. You could pick one up off the streets tommorrow when Denver realeases Brandon Stokley. The Vikings got one in Greg Caramillo in a trade for their 5th CB. A 7th round draft pick is pretty much the right market value for that kind of player.
